Project Canvas Renders Vector UI via Gemini 3.0 Ultra
Google introduced Project Canvas at I/O 2026, an AI design platform powered by Gemini 3.0 Ultra that generates editable multi-page marketing materials.
Google launched Project Canvas at Google I/O 2026, positioning an AI-native generative design engine directly inside the Workspace ecosystem. Powered by the newly announced Gemini 3.0 Ultra model, the platform uses a prompt-to-workflow engine to generate multi-page marketing collateral, UI/UX wireframes, and social media kits from a single natural language description.
Gemini 3.0 Ultra and Spatial Reasoning
Traditional image generation models produce static raster files. Project Canvas utilizes a specialized “Design Decoder” architecture in Gemini 3.0 Ultra fine-tuned for spatial reasoning and layout aesthetics. The model understands foundational design principles like white space, visual hierarchy, and brand consistency.
During I/O Sandbox sessions, early testers confirmed the platform supports Live Layers. This feature renders generated elements as editable vector paths rather than flattened pixels. If you build multimodal applications, this shift from pixel generation to coordinate-based vector generation represents a significant architectural difference, moving AI outputs directly into professional editing workflows.
Brand Enforcement and Accessibility
To solve the homogenization problem common in generative design, Google introduced Style Sync. The feature extracts HEX codes, typography, and brand voice from a single uploaded brand asset, such as a logo or PDF, and enforces these constraints across all generated outputs.
Project Canvas also includes Voice Design, an accessibility feature that accepts verbal commands for building and editing layouts. This lowers the barrier to entry for educators and small business owners creating complex materials without technical design software.
Pricing and Availability
The tool operates both as a standalone application and as an integrated sidebar within Google Docs and Google Slides. If your organization uses the Workspace MCP Server or other enterprise tooling, these design capabilities now sit directly beside document creation.
| Tier | Price | Key Features | Availability |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standard | $19.99/mo (Google One AI Premium) | Base Project Canvas generation | Preview in US/UK |
| Pro | Part of Gemini Business add-on | Advanced team collaboration, 8K exports | Global Q3 2026 |
The preview rollout began for Google Workspace Labs users in the U.S. and U.K. on May 19, 2026. A global release is scheduled for Q3 2026.
